Ahhh, now people here are making the assumption that its a standard bearing size, which it isn't, I know this as I took mine into a bearing suppliers and they told me its a non-standard size so they couldn't help.

God knows why FSA did this but they have with just this headset. Anyhow, only place to get them is via windwave, and as they don't sell them directly, so your best bet it to go through ukbikestore as they are just down the road from them and will walk down pick the bit up and put it in the post for you.
